ftp://ftp.dgii.com/pub/uiarchive

Might have a copy... I saved most of UI's archive when UNIX International
went under, and Digi International (formerly Digiboard) was kind
enough to give it a home on the net.  I know there is some advanced
FS white papaers, some user asn system administration research,
and DWARF and a draft copy of SPEC1170, among other things.
